Avatar billede latino_boy Nybegynder
30. maj 2006 - 18:29 Der er 14 kommentarer og
1 løsning

Database i my SQL

Jeg står og er ved at lave en hjemmeside, og jeg har fundet ud af min server ikke understøtter access, jeg mangler derfor en Database som kan arbejde samme med min hjemmeside ( ASP ) det jeg mangler er en database som kan registrer Navn, Adresse,Alder,By,fødselsdato,land,post nummer,email,brugernavn,password,gentag password. dett er for at databasen kan arbejde sammen med min hjemmeside, hvor brugerne skal registrer sig hvor de bagefter kan logge ind, jeg skal bare sikre mig at brugerne ikke vælger samme navn osv.

Håber meget i kan hjæpe, der er 200 point ude for den rigtige løsning, håber meget på jeres hjælp

Mvh

Alexander
Avatar billede beepopper Nybegynder
30. maj 2006 - 18:44 #1
De der hoster din hjemmeside tilbyder vel en eller anden form for databasesystem? Det nemmeste er vel at bruge det system.

Bortset fra det vil jeg da foreslå at du lige overvejer hvordan du designer din database. Den kunne nok godt tåle en normalisering så den ikke fyldes med redundante data.
Avatar billede ladyhawke Novice
30. maj 2006 - 19:02 #2
der er ingen grund til at opbevare "gentag password" i din base? Det er i din brugergrænseflade du skal tjekke om password og gentag password er ens... Når du lægger informationerne i basen skal de jo være ens, ellers giver det ikke mening
Avatar billede latino_boy Nybegynder
30. maj 2006 - 19:28 #3
det forstår jeg godt, det er jeg med på nu hehe, men vil hører om i kunne lave sådan en database til det formål. jeg har webhotel ved B-one og de tilbyder ikke acess hvilket ikke er særlig smart men de understøtter derfor MY SQL hvilket de også selv forslår man brger
Avatar billede ladyhawke Novice
30. maj 2006 - 19:58 #4
nu skal du ikke underkende MySQL... Access er bestemt ikke nødvendigvis en suveræn løsning til web...

Hvorfor laver du ikke basen selv, der er en masse gode vejledninger til det og så ved du hvad der foregår (og kan ændre det efter behov/lyst - ikke kun når nogen har tid til at gøre det for dig)
Avatar billede latino_boy Nybegynder
30. maj 2006 - 23:12 #5
Det er fordi jeg ikke kan programmere i My SQL det er der problemet ligger. så håber der er en venlig sjæl der vil lave en lille database til mig da jeg skal bruge det til min hjemmeside
Avatar billede ladyhawke Novice
31. maj 2006 - 12:29 #6
Det er lige netop det jeg mener, hvis du lader andre lave den nu, så kan du heller ikke "programmere" i MySQL næste gang du skal lave noget om ved din side, som indvolverer databasen...

Prøv f.eks. at kigge her: http://dev.mysql.com/doc/refman/5.1/en/index.html

Hvad laver du hjemmesiden i? (så er det nemmere at finde en vejledning til dig)

Jeg vil ikke lave den for dig, men gerne hjælpe hvis du selv går igang
Avatar billede latino_boy Nybegynder
31. maj 2006 - 12:47 #7
det lyder helt fair, det er selvfølgelig også den bedste løsning. Jeg laver den i Html/men nogle af mine sider indeholder ASP såsom registrering af brugerne og mit login system. Men primært HTML
Avatar billede ladyhawke Novice
31. maj 2006 - 17:00 #8
ok, ASP er altså det du bruger.

Her er et lille eksempel du kan afprøve på din egen maskine, inkl. installationsvejledning. Så skal du i dit program bare rette til baseret på din hosts oplysninger (+ oprette/uploade en tilsvarende base/tabel der)
Avatar billede latino_boy Nybegynder
31. maj 2006 - 18:02 #9
det forstod jeg ikke helt? er ikke så god indenfor det her beklager meget. kan du uddybe det lidt?
Avatar billede ladyhawke Novice
31. maj 2006 - 19:38 #10
Jo da: Det eksempel jeg sendte et link på er en beskrivelse for hvordan du kommer igang på din egen maskine. Prøv det først, så kan du "lege" med det inden du lægger noget ud på WWW.

Du har jo så en host/web hotel hvor din kommende hjemmeside skal køre. Det vil kræve at du dels ændrer indstillingerner i din applikation vedr. databasens placering mm. De oplysninger har du fået (eller kan få) fra din host og dels skal du oprette eller kopiere tabellen til hosten, så du har de samme oplysninger dér. Men sig til når du kommer så langt.
Avatar billede latino_boy Nybegynder
31. maj 2006 - 22:20 #11
jeg har været inde på det link du sendte og jeg syes det er rigtig godt der er meget hjælp og hente osv, men hvis jeg vil til og lave nogle script og kommandoer hvilket af programmerne skal jeg så vælge? jeg valgte et af dem men synes ikke det gad fungere..
Avatar billede ladyhawke Novice
01. juni 2006 - 12:44 #12
så er du nødt til at forklare dig nærmere, f.eks. hvilket program valgte du og hvad gjorde du for at få det til at virke? Og lige et opklarende spørgsmål: er det fordi du vil prøve at skrive/udføre sql kommandoer på den base du har installeret på din maskine?
Avatar billede latino_boy Nybegynder
01. juni 2006 - 13:19 #13
Jeg installerede mysql-5.0.22-win32 jeg ved ikke om det er det helt rigtige jeg har fat i, men det jeg gerne vil at jeg gerne vil udføre mine egene kommadoer for at derefter kunne opbygge egen databse i MySQL.
Avatar billede ladyhawke Novice
02. juni 2006 - 12:29 #14
den fil du installerede er selve mysql databasen
den kan du starte fra en kommando prompt, prøv at kigge denne vejledning igennem:

http://www.stardeveloper.com/articles/display.html?article=2003052201&page=1


Der findes også forskellige grafisk værktøjer til det, men det ændrer ikke så meget ved det basale i opgaven.
Avatar billede latino_boy Nybegynder
05. juli 2012 - 23:02 #15
lukket
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ester



IT-JOB